⑴ 程序员升职记攻略
程序员升职记攻略
要成功升职为程序员,你需要掌握一系列技能和策略,并不断提升自己的专业能力和领导力。以下是一些关键的攻略,帮助你在职业生涯中脱颖而出。
首先,精通技术能力是升职的基础。作为程序员,你需要不断学习新的编程语言和框架,并保持对最新技术的敏感度。此外,参与开源项目或社区活动也是提升技术能力的好方法。通过分享你的知识和经验,你不仅能够建立自己的个人品牌,还能够结识更多同行和潜在雇主。
其次,良好的沟通和团队合作能力也是升职的关键。程序员往往需要与其他团队成员密切合作,共同完成项目。因此,你需要学会有效地与同事、上级和客户沟通。通过主动承担团队责任、积极参与团队讨论和解决问题,你能够展示自己的领导潜力,并为升职创造更多机会。
此外,持续学习和自我提升也是程序员升职的重要因素。随着技术的快速发展,你需要保持对新知识的渴望和学习能力。参加培训课程、阅读专业书籍、关注行业动态等都是提升自我价值的途径。同时,积极参加公司内部的晋升培训和领导力发展计划,也能够为你的升职之路提供有力支持。
总之,要成功升职为程序员,你需要不断提升自己的技术能力、沟通能力和自我学习能力。通过积极参与团队工作、展示领导潜力并持续自我提升,你将在职业生涯中取得更大的成功。记住,升职不是一蹴而就的过程,而是需要长期的努力和积累。保持耐心和热情,相信自己的能力,你一定能够实现自己的职业目标。
⑵ 程序员工作5年,还是个中级程序员,如何再快速晋升
在探索程序员如何快速晋升至高级或更高级别岗位的过程中,关键在于识别并解决职业发展的瓶颈。首先,明确自己的职业规划至关重要,这不仅仅是薪酬的追求,更应是技术深度与广度的提升,找到一个自己热爱并能持续投入的领域。
技术方向的选择需慎重,如C/C++开发,具备广泛的技术应用领域,从游戏开发到网络通信,每一个方向都能带来不同的挑战与机遇。因此,专注于某一领域深入学习,将有助于构建坚实的技术基础,并在该领域达到专业水平。
提升技术层次是晋升的关键,但高效的学习方式同样重要。书籍是获取知识的宝贵资源,但系统性学习与实际操作的结合更为关键。付费学习课程提供结构化的学习路径,减少学习过程中的迷茫与重复,同时确保技术内容的准确性和权威性。
在C/C++后端开发领域,系统的技术学习课程可以全面覆盖数据结构、算法、设计模式、Linux工程管理、高性能网络设计、基础组件设计、中间件开发、开源框架、云原生技术、性能分析、分布式架构等关键领域。通过这些课程,可以建立起扎实的技术基础,并在实际项目中得到应用与验证。
技术学习不仅限于提升个人技能,还应关注行业动态、薪资水平与职业发展路径。学习过程中,与同行交流、了解不同城市、不同技术方向的市场情况,对于规划职业生涯具有重要意义。
最后,对于不同阶段的程序员,有不同的建议与寄语:校招的伙伴应珍惜机会,争取进入大厂,为未来职业发展奠定坚实基础;对于1-3年的程序员,应保持学习热情,积极适应市场需求的变化;35岁以上的程序员则需聚焦技术深度与广度,不断提升自我价值。
希望此学习路线能够为程序员提供有价值的指导,促进职业成长与个人发展。码农之路,任重而道远,持续学习、勇于探索,定能迈向更高的职业境界。